Armada and North Branch are an even 3-3 against one another since August of 2018, but not for long. The Armada Tigers have the luxury of staying home for another week and will welcome the North Branch Broncos at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. The two teams have allowed few points on average, (Armada: 9.3, North Branch: 7.7) so any points scored will be well earned.
Armada is probably headed into the match with a chip on their shoulder considering Almont just ended the team's five-game winning streak on Friday. They were just a hair shy of victory and fell 29-28 to the Raiders. That makes it the first time this season the Tigers have let down their home crowd.
Armada might have lost, but man, Jackson Malburg was a machine: he rushed for 236 yards and a touchdown. Another back making a difference was Logan Chunn, who rushed for 35 yards and two touchdowns.
He was just one part of a punishing run game: Armada was unstoppable on the ground and finished the game with 282 rushing yards. That strong performance was nothing new for the team: they've now rushed for at least 167 rushing yards in seven consecutive matchups dating back to last season.
Meanwhile, North Branch won against Richmond last Friday with 28 points and they decided to stick to that point total again on Friday. North Branch took down Yale 28-14. The victory made it back-to-back wins for the Broncos.
Having lost for the first time this season, Armada fell to 5-1. As for North Branch, their win bumped their record up to 5-1-1.
Armada came out on top in a nail-biter against North Branch in their previous matchup back in October of 2023, sneaking past 22-19. Will Armada repeat their success, or does North Branch have a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
